1 2 3 4 5 6 Grant CommentsOutput power listed is conducted. This device supports 20MHz/40MHz bandwidths. SAR compliance for body-worn accessory operation is based on a separation distance of 1.5 cm between the unit and the body of the user. Belt clips, holsters and other body-worn accessories may not contain metallic components. End-users must be informed of the body worn operating requirements for satisfying RF exposure compliance. The highest reported SAR values for head, body-worn, Product Specific, and simultaneous exposure conditions are 1.27W/Kg, 0.22W/Kg, 0.58 W/kg(10g), and 1.39W/kg respectively.
1 2 3 4 5 6 Power output listed is ERP for bands below 1 GHz and EIRP for bands above 1 GHz. This device supports LTE bandwidths of: 20/15/10/5/3/1.4 MHz under Part 24E (LTE Band 2, 1850-1910 MHz), 10/5/3/1.4 MHz under Part 22 (LTE Band 5, 824-849 MHz), 20/15/10/5 MHz under Part 27 (LTE Band 7, 2500-2570 MHz). SAR compliance for body-worn accessory operation is based on a separation distance of 1.5 cm between the unit and the body of the user. Belt clips, holsters and other body-worn accessories may not contain metallic components. End users must be informed of the body worn operating requirements for satisfying RF exposure compliance. The highest reported SAR for head, body worn accessory, product specific (wireless router), and simultaneous transmission exposure conditions are 0.24 W/kg, 0.37 W/kg, 0.82W/kg, and 1.39 W/kg, respectively. This device also contains functions that are not operational in U.S. Territories. This filing is only applicable for US operations.
